- W4366000433 abstract "Herein we report the effect of the Cr3+ content on the distinctive features of the first-ever auto-combustion-synthesis-produced Cr3+ doped ZnO nanoparticles utilizing leucine as the fuel. To assess the impact of fuel and Cr3+ content on the structural, optical, and luminescence characteristics, as-synthesized powders were systematically examined using powder XRD, UV–Visible, and Photoluminescence spectroscopy. Structural studies show that the exothermicity of the redox mixture containing oxidizer and fuel combination leads to the development of polycrystalline, single-phase, and nanosized particles. XRD analysis shows that, reduced crystallite size with Cr3+ content. In contrast, other characteristics like lattice parameters, unit cell volume, strain, and dislocation density, were shown to increase linearly with Cr3+ concentration up to 7 mol%. Additionally, it is seen that the predicted Urbach energy values rise as Cr3+ is added to the ZnO host matrix, indicating that the substitution of Cr3+ for Zn in the host ZnO lattice has increased structural disorder. In contrast to the other samples, the 5 mol% Cr3+ doped ZnO sample exhibits the emission near the white region according to the PL emission measurements. Furthermore, the photocatalytic activity of the as-prepared Cr3+ doped ZnO NPs was examined. It was found that the as-prepared samples exhibit outstanding photocatalytic activity in the visible wavelength region against Malachite Green (MG) dye. Among all, 9 mol% Cr3+ doped ZnO has shown the maximum 95.4% degradation against MG dye. All the investigated results conclude that the produced Cr3+ doped ZnO nanoparticles could be exploited in a variety of upcoming optoelectronic and photocatalytic applications." @default.
